Description
Globalization: A Critical Introduction by Jan Aart Scholte provides a comprehensive overview of this complex and multifaceted phenomenon. The second edition builds upon the author's core argument that supraterritoriality is globalization's most distinctive feature, while expanding its scope to cover other dimensions of globalization. Scholte offers a nuanced analysis of the rise of globalization, examining its various forms and manifestations. This revised edition includes new material to reflect the evolving nature of globalization in the 21st century. By exploring the complexities of globalization, this book offers a valuable resource for students and scholars seeking to understand the intricacies of this globalising world.
